Transaction dc277f996715fe5f9512e05287213ffedf578e59c7bf1a217f8a52eac7f0c5e0

block
d405a38950e4f1c2f9fe2453905070313df0d974e86fc18b33ecd27a1c5789ec

1 Input

23 Outputs